    What was your plan heading into the inaugural draft?
    Going in I was all about cap management and picking guys around 23-25 yrs of age to compete immediately and to remain competitive (Seguin, Krug, Kreider, Barkov) for 4-5 seasons to follow. Half way through the draft I noticed nobody was taking top end prospect defenseman, so I loaded up on them (Theodore, Morrissey, Pulock) and eventually flipped them for productive mid/late-twenty yr old players with great contracts. (Ellis,Pacioretty/Dadonov,Josi).

    Very smart planning and strategy implementation....speaking of strategy, should more teams follow suit and not participate in JR drafts? Seems like quite the successful strategy for you....
    haha, I don’t recommend it now after our keeper number was raised by 5 players. Three things came into play as to why I trade all my picks away in the JR and Pro draft (Havanablast traded me a 10th back at zero hour, so technically one late pick in the last round)

    1. I was going hard for the title, had the best record and best fantasy points in the league. Lots of injuries hit (Bishop, Patches, Thornton, Kreider etc) but I pushed hard to try and win it all…. Then laid an egg in the first round.
    2. I wanted the summer off, I wasn’t going to be around for most of the draft and never had time to really research the newbies, so might as well get rid of the picks
    3. With our current keeper settings, I wasn’t too worried, knowing I would be able to grab talented prospects off the wire after teams would be forced to drop someone if they never made the big club. This is out of the question now with our new 5 keeper spots, there won’t be shit on the wire this season!
